Summary:

The 02780 zip code area of Taunton, Massachusetts is home to 6 elementary schools serving students from preschool through 4th grade. While the schools generally perform below the Taunton district and Massachusetts state averages, a few schools stand out in the data.

Joseph C Chamberlain has the highest proficiency rates in both English Language Arts and Mathematics across all grades, and is the highest ranked school in the Taunton district, ranking 610th out of 906 Massachusetts elementary schools. It also has the highest spending per student at $15,144. Edmund Hatch Bennett has the highest 3rd grade proficiency rates in both subjects and is the second highest ranked school in the Taunton district, ranking 638th out of 906.

However, the data shows a significant drop in proficiency rates from 3rd grade to 4th grade across the schools, particularly in Mathematics, suggesting potential challenges in maintaining student performance as they progress through the elementary grades. While higher spending may contribute to better performance, as seen with Joseph C Chamberlain, it is not a guarantee of improved outcomes, as evidenced by the relatively lower performance of H H Galligan despite its high spending. The consistently low performance across the schools, relative to the Taunton district and Massachusetts state averages, suggests that the 02780 zip code area may face broader educational challenges that need to be addressed.
